ワークフロースタジオ でのプレイブックへのユーザーアクセス

  • リリースバージョン: Zurich
  • 更新日 2025年07月31日
  • 所要時間:6分
  • アドミニストレーターは、委託開発権限をアサインするかユーザーロールを直接アサインして、ユーザーにプレイブックに対するアクセス権を付与できます。また、アドミニストレーターは、ユーザーのロールに基づいて、ユーザーがアクセスできる機能とコンテンツを指定することもできます。

    ユーザーロール別のアクセス

    アドミニストレーターは、ユーザーにアクティビティ定義を表示するロールが含まれる pd_author ユーザーロールを直接アサインすることによって ワークフロースタジオ のプレイブックへのアクセス権限を許可できます。

    表 : 1. ワークフロースタジオのプレイブックのロール
    ロール 説明 含まれるロール
    playbook.admin ユーザーは次のことができます。
    • トリガー定義を作成、更新、削除する。
    • ワークフロースタジオ を起動して、プレイブックを作成、アクティブ化、編集、削除する。
    • アクティビティ定義を作成、編集、削除する。
    • プレイブックプレイブックエクスペリエンス によって共有されるエクスペリエンスアクティビティタイプ (sys_pd_activity) テーブルとエクスペリエンスアクティビティプロパティ (sys_pd_activity_type_prop) テーブルを表示する。
    • pd_author
    • pd_content_author
    • pd_trigger_author
    • pd_operator
    • pd_cancel
    pd_author ユーザーは次のことができます。
    • ワークフロースタジオ を起動して、プレイブックを作成、アクティブ化、編集、削除する。
    • すべてのアクティビティ定義を表示する。
    • プレイブックプレイブックエクスペリエンス によって共有されるエクスペリエンスアクティビティタイプ (sys_pd_activity) テーブルとエクスペリエンスアクティビティプロパティ (sys_pd_activity_type_prop) テーブルを表示する。
    • pd_shared.user
    • playbook.write
    • playbook.activity_def_read
    pd_content_author ユーザーは次のことができます。
    • アクティビティ定義を作成、編集、削除する。
    • トリガー定義を作成、編集、削除する。
    • プレイブックプレイブックエクスペリエンス によって共有されるエクスペリエンスアクティビティタイプ (sys_pd_activity) テーブルとエクスペリエンスアクティビティプロパティ (sys_pd_activity_type_prop) テーブルを表示する。
    • pd_trigger_author
    • pd_shared.user
    • playbook.activity_def_read
    pd_trigger_author ユーザーがトリガー定義を作成、更新、削除できるようにします。 なし
    pd_operator ユーザーがプロセス実行、アクティビティ実行、実行ログの表示のみをできるようにします。 なし
    pd_shared.user プレイブック および プレイブックエクスペリエンスで共有されるエクスペリエンスアクティビティタイプ (sys_pd_activity) テーブルとエクスペリエンスアクティビティプロパティ (sys_pd_activity_type_prop) テーブルを表示できるようにします。 なし
    pd_shared.admin プレイブック および プレイブックエクスペリエンスで共有されるエクスペリエンスアクティビティタイプ (sys_pd_activity) テーブルとエクスペリエンスアクティビティプロパティ (sys_pd_activity_type_prop) テーブルを編集できるようにします。 pd_shared.user
    pd_cancel playbook.admin ロールまたは親レコードへの書き込みアクセス権なしで実行中のプレイブックをキャンセルできるようにします。たとえば、プレイブックをキャンセルする機能をエージェントマネージャーに付与しても、エージェントには付与しない場合などです。 なし
    pd_restarter アクティブなプレイブックを再起動できるようにします。 なし
    playbook.write コンテンツフィルタリング制限のあるユーザーが次の操作を行えるようにします。
    • ワークフロースタジオ を起動して、プレイブックを作成、アクティブ化、編集、削除する。
    • プレイブックプレイブックエクスペリエンス によって共有されるエクスペリエンスアクティビティタイプ (sys_pd_activity) テーブルとエクスペリエンスアクティビティプロパティ (sys_pd_activity_type_prop) テーブルを表示する。
    コンテンツアクセスフィルタリングの詳細については、「 プレイブックのコンテンツフィルタリング」を参照してください。
    pd_shared.user
    playbook.designer_access コンテンツフィルタリングが制限されているユーザーが ワークフロースタジオ を起動してプレイブックを表示できるようにします。コンテンツアクセスフィルタリングの詳細については、「 プレイブックのコンテンツフィルタリング」を参照してください。 pd_shared.user
    playbook.activity_def_read 必要なロールがない限り、ユーザーがすべてのアクティビティ定義を表示できるようにします。 なし
    ロールが含まれている場所の視覚的表現:
    • playbook.admin
      • pd_content_author
        • playbook.activity_def_read
        • pd_shared.user
        • pd_trigger_author
      • pd_operator
      • pd_cancel
      • pd_restarter
      • pd_author
        • playbook.write
          • playbook.designer_access
            • pd_shared.user
            • sn_workflow_studio.workflow_studio_read
              注:
              このロールでは、ユーザーは ワークフロースタジオ を起動できますが、プレイブックアドミニストレーターによって管理されることはありません。
            • sn_diagram_builder.db_read
              注:
              このロールでは、ユーザーは ワークフロースタジオ のダイアグラムビューでプレイブックを表示できますが、プレイブックアドミニストレーターによって管理されることはありません。
        • playbook.activity_def_read
      • pd_shared.admin
        • pd_shared.user
    • delegated_developer

    委託開発アクセス

    アドミニストレーターは、アプリケーションを作成し、プレイブック委託開発権限を持つ開発者としてユーザーをアサインすることにより、ユーザーに ワークフロースタジオ プレイブックへのアクセス権限を付与できます。委託開発を使用すると、アドミニストレーターは、通常はアドミンユーザーに制限されている機能にプレイブック作成者がアクセスできるかどうかを制御できます。詳細については、「開発者権限」を参照してください。

    ロールベースのコンテンツのフィルタリング

    ワークフロースタジオ プレイブックのコンテンツにアクセスするために必要なユーザーロールを指定します。たとえば、アクティビティ定義やプロセス定義などです。コンテンツ定義とコンテンツフィルタリングルールを作成して、コンテンツのフィルタリングを管理します。詳細については、「プレイブックのコンテンツフィルタリング」を参照してください。

    ロールベースのアクティビティ定義へのアクセス

    アクティビティ定義にアクセスするために必要なロールを指定して、アクティビティ定義へのアクセスを管理します。プレイブックを表示できるが、このアクティビティ定義を使用してアクティビティにアクセスするために必要なロールを持たないユーザーには、プレイブックの読み取り専用ビューが表示されます。


    制限付きアクティビティ定義のワークフロースタジオのアクティビティの読み取り専用ビュー
    アクティビティ定義の詳細については、「 アクティビティ定義の作成 」および「 アクティビティ定義」を参照してください。
    注:
    playbook.admin ロールと pd_content_author ロールの両方がアクティビティ定義を編集できますが、[必要なロール] フィールドを編集できるのは playbook.admin ロールのみです。